Estendere la portata dei diritti umani internazionali per includere i diritti economici, sociali e culturali come la cosiddetta seconda generazione di diritti umani è emersa verso la fine del 19° secolo, ma da allora ha ricevuto un rilievo speciale principalmente attraverso le attività dell’International Labour Organizzazione delle Nazioni Unite per l’educazione, la scienza e la cultura (OIL) e l’Organizzazione delle Nazioni Unite per l’educazione, la scienza e la cultura (UNESCO). Si ricorda anche che c’è stato un tempo in cui il controllo e la regolamentazione dell’economia da parte del governo erano quasi inesistenti negli Stati Uniti d’America, perché ciò era visto come una manifestazione del comunismo. Tuttavia, il New Deal avviato dal presidente Franklin D. Roosevelt (1882-1945) per superare gli effetti devastanti della Grande Depressione degli anni ’30 ha portato un cambiamento radicale in questo senso. Il New Deal è stato progettato per stabilizzare l’economia attraverso il controllo legislativo e le iniziative governative, e il diritto commerciale è diventato quindi una componente importante della disposizione legale americana. Le direttive dell’ILO hanno contribuito allo sviluppo delle iniziative del New Deal. Anche l’UNESCO ha svolto un ruolo di primo piano in tutto il mondo.
